DO NOT INSTALL THE PRODUCT NEAR HEAT SOURCES. •• Do not drop the product while moving. •• Do not install the product in poorly ventilated spaces such as a bookcase or closet. •• Install the product at least 10 cm away from the wall to allow ventilation. •• Keep the plastic packaging out of the reach of children. ‒‒ Children may suffocate.
Operation Warning •• There is a high voltage inside the product. Never disassemble, repair or modify the product yourself. ‒‒ Contact Samsung Customer Service Center for repairs. •• To move the product, first disconnect all the cables from it, including the power cable. •• If the product generates abnormal sounds, a burning smell or smoke, disconnect the power cord immediately and contact Samsung Customer Service Center.
Caution •• Leaving the screen fixed on a stationary image for an extended period of time may cause afterimage burn-in or defective pixels. ‒‒ Activate power-saving mode or a moving-picture screen saver if you will not be using the product for an extended period of time. •• Disconnect the power cord from the power socket if you do not plan on using the product for an extended period of time (vacation, etc). ‒‒ Dust accumulation combined with heat can cause a fire, electric shock or electric leakage.

TÜV Rheinland “Low Blue Light Content” is a certification for products which meet requirements for lower blue light levels. When Eye Saver Mode is 'On', the blue light that wavelength is around 400nm will decrease, and it will provide an optimum picture quality suitable for eye relaxation.

HDMI Black Level Coarse If a DVD player or set-top box is connected to the product via HDMI, image quality degradation (contrast/ color degradation, black level, etc.) may occur, depending on the connected source device. In such case, HDMI Black Level can be used to adjust the image quality. Adjust the screen frequency. ――This menu is available in Analog mode only. If this is the case, correct the degraded picture quality using HDMI Black Level. ――This function is only available in HDMI mode.

Color Tone Adjust the general color tone of the picture. ――This menu is not available when SAMSUNGAngle is enabled. MAGIC •• Cool 2: Set the color temperature to be cooler than Cool 1. •• Cool 1: Set the color temperature to be cooler than Normal mode. •• Normal: Display the standard color tone. •• Warm 1: Set the color temperature to be warmer than Normal mode. •• Warm 2: Set the color temperature to be warmer than Warm 1. •• Custom: Customize the color tone.

Extended warranty You can buy an extended warranty within 90 days of purchasing the product. The extended warranty will cover an additional period of 3 years, beyond the standard 3 year warranty. Samsung guarantee that replacement parts will be available for 5 years after the end of production. After 5 years, in the event that the Samsung’s service center has run out of replacement parts and cannot repair the product, Samsung will replace your product at no additional charge.
